Reviewer 2 Report

Paper deals with important task. The authors improved resampling particle filter algorithm based on adaptive multi-feature fusion.

Paper has elements of scientific novelty and great practical value.

It has a logical structure. The paper is technically sound. The experimental section is good.

The proposed approach is logical, results are clear.

Suggestions:

1.       The introduction section should be extended using more clearly the motivation of this paper.

2.       The authors should add a strong related works section as there are a lot of methods in this field. It would be good to use these papers: DOI 10.1109/DSMP.2016.7583531; DOI 10.1109/CADSM.2015.7230806 among others

3.       It is unclear why the authors introduced a kernel function but not used existing ones. It should be argued.

4.       It would be good to explain how the proposed approach will work with the video of high resolution.

5.       The conclusion section should be extended using: 1) numerical results obtained in the paper; 2) limitations of the proposed approach; 3) prospects for future research.
